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"despite the recognition of"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to indicate that something occurs or is true even though there is an acknowledgment or awareness of a particular fact or situation. Example: "Despite the recognition of the challenges ahead, the team remained optimistic about their project."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Use "despite the recognition of" to acknowledge a known factor that doesn't negate the subsequent statement. It adds a layer of nuance, showing you're aware of potential counterarguments.
Common error
Avoid using "despite the recognition of" when the recognition is the direct cause of the subsequent event. "Despite" implies a contrast, not a cause-and-effect relationship.

Linguistic Context
The phrase "despite the recognition of" functions as a prepositional phrase that introduces a contrasting element or concession. As Ludwig AI confirms, it acknowledges a known factor before presenting an opposing or unexpected outcome. The phrase sets up a relationship where the expected consequence of the recognized element does not occur.

FAQs
How can I use "despite the recognition of" in a sentence?
Use "despite the recognition of" to introduce a statement that contrasts with a known or acknowledged fact. For example, "Despite the recognition of the challenges, the project moved forward."
What are some alternatives to "despite the recognition of"?
You can use alternatives like "in spite of acknowledging", "notwithstanding the awareness of", or "even with the acknowledgment of".
Is "despite the recognition of" formal or informal?
"Despite the recognition of" is generally considered formal and suitable for academic, professional, and journalistic writing. More informal options might include "even though" or "although".
What's the difference between "despite the recognition of" and "because of the recognition of"?
"Despite the recognition of" indicates a contrast, meaning something happens in spite of the acknowledged fact. "Because of the recognition of" indicates a cause-and-effect relationship, meaning something happens as a result of the acknowledged fact.
